Energy Efficiency
9, Collins Close, Birmingham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of F.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 01 Jul 2013.
The property is connected to mains gas and has partial double glazing.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 9, Collins Close, Birmingham completed on 18th December 2013 at £124,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
Values of comparable properties have risen by 69.1% over the period since December 2013.
